Volvo D11 Engine Specifications

The Volvo D11 engine is a robust and efficient powertrain designed for heavy-duty applications, particularly in commercial vehicles and construction equipment. Known for its reliability and performance, the D11 engine is a popular choice among fleet operators and manufacturers. Below are the detailed specifications of the Volvo D11 engine.

Specification Details
Engine Type Inline 6-cylinder, 4-stroke diesel engine
Displacement 10.8 liters
Bore x Stroke 127 mm x 154 mm
Compression Ratio 18.0:1
Power Output 330 – 460 hp (245 – 343 kW)
Torque 1,400 – 2,200 Nm
Fuel System Common rail direct fuel injection
Turbocharger Variable geometry turbocharger
Cooling System Water-cooled
Weight Approximately 1,100 kg

Engine Configuration

The Volvo D11 engine features a well-thought-out design that enhances performance and efficiency. Its inline 6-cylinder configuration allows for smooth operation and balanced power delivery. The engine is equipped with advanced technologies that contribute to its fuel efficiency and reduced emissions.

Key Features of the Engine Configuration

  • Inline 6-cylinder design for optimal balance and smoothness.
  • Common rail fuel injection system for precise fuel delivery.
  • Variable geometry turbocharger for improved performance across various RPM ranges.
  • Integrated engine brake system for enhanced braking performance.
  • Robust construction for durability in demanding applications.

Engine Oil Specifications

Proper lubrication is crucial for the longevity and performance of the Volvo D11 engine. The engine oil specifications are designed to ensure optimal operation under various conditions.

Recommended Engine Oil

The following are the recommended engine oil specifications for the Volvo D11:

Specification Details
Oil Type Synthetic or semi-synthetic diesel engine oil
Viscosity Grade 10W-30, 10W-40, or 15W-40
API Classification API CI-4 or higher
ACEA Classification ACEA E7 or higher

Service Intervals

Regular maintenance is essential for the optimal performance of the Volvo D11 engine. Adhering to the recommended service intervals can help prevent premature wear and ensure the engine operates efficiently.

Recommended Service Intervals

The following service intervals are generally recommended for the Volvo D11 engine:

  • Oil Change: Every 15,000 to 30,000 km or every 12 months, whichever comes first.
  • Oil Filter Replacement: Every oil change.
  • Fuel Filter Replacement: Every 30,000 km.
  • Air Filter Replacement: Every 30,000 km or as needed based on operating conditions.
  • Coolant Replacement: Every 5 years or as specified by the manufacturer.
